Where do we go next?

Once we recognize underdeveloped jaws and mouth breathing are the root cause of the symptoms we are noticing we can actually do something to solve the problem rather then treating the symptoms. 

To get your child back on track we need to guide the growth of the jaws back to where nature intended them to be. The best time to do that is before all the permanent adult teeth come. 

 

The process

01

Bring your child in for a complementary consultation

We'll get a thorough history of what you have experienced so far and any prior treatments or surgeries. Our team will take pictures and 3D images of your child's mouth and Dr. Kamodia will do an oral evaluation.

02

Come back to discuss your child's treatment needs

Dr. Kamodia will bring only the parents back on a different day to review what she has learned about their child from the last visit and talk about the specific treatment plan that would be best for each child.

03

Begin treatment

Every child starts by learning about nasal hygiene and practicing myofunctional exercises. From there some children would benefit from an expander while others only a growth guidance appliance. This part of the plan is customized to your child.

04

Follow up

You'll have regular follow up appointments so we can monitor progress closely at the beginning. Once we are seeing progress and results we can move to quarterly or biannual follow up visits.
